STS Aviation Services is hiring a P2F Project Manager in Manchester, United Kingdom. Position Summary: Reporting to the P2F Programme Manager, the P2F Project Manager is responsible for ensuring the execution of the build plan. This build plan is to be managed accurately on a day-to-day basis, coordinating the cross functional support teams to deliver parts, documentation, engineering and resources on time and in line with the input delivery schedule. Duties & Responsibilities:
  • Proactively manage the P2F build plans on a day to day basis, ensuring timely completion of each stage and organisation of all elements for the forecasted next worksteps
  • Communicates effectively and accurately with the cross functional team from Planning, Supply Chain, Tooling and Engineering ensuring support functions meet the input schedule.
  • Communicate with the aircraft`s Check Managers and Zonal leaders, understanding input status, defining next worksteps and agreeing the allocation of appropriate resources.
  • Ensures P2F documentation is completed accurately and in a timely manner  Responsible for oversight of the manhour and budget control of the P2F build plan, ensuring any estimated manhours are realistic and achievable supporting Customer approval
  • Produce and communicate daily and weekly reports as requested.
  • Highlight and support resolution to any obstacles that could affect the smooth running of the build plan.
  • Liaise with resource planning to ensure continuity and efficiency in allocated manpower
  • Use of continuous improvement methodology, using lessons learnt to improve efficiencies of each subsequent input.
Skills & Abilities:
  • Demonstrable project planning and management experience with successful project delivery
  • Minimum of 8 years aircraft experience.
  • Previous aircraft modification or production supervisory experience essential.  Comprehensive understanding of Aircraft structures and knowledge of manufacturing.
  • Ability to build and maintain effective cross-team working relationships  Organisation skills.
  • Excellent leadership and communication skills.
Qualifications:
  • Recognised training & qualification in Project Management
  • Degree level education in operations or manufacturing engineering, or equivalent demonstrable experience preferred
